資源簡介
本在線影評系統利用jsp動態網頁技術和MySql數據庫,以B/S模式開發,實現電影的動態發布和管理。前臺為用戶提供了電影搜索、分類和評論等功能;管理用戶可以通過Web瀏覽器登陸后臺實現電影的刪除,添加。

代碼片段和文件信息
package?beans;
import?java.sql.*;
import?com.sun.rowset.CachedRowSetImpl;
public?class?database?{
//?格式輸出
StringBuffer?queryResult;
//?Vector?vector=new?Vector();
//?定義變量,id,pic,moviename,daoyan,zhuyan,difang,pianchang,leibie,pingfen,shangyingshijian
String?keyword?=?““;//
int?id?pianchang;
float?pingfen;
int?shangyingshijian;
String?pic?=?““?moviename?=?““?daoyan?=?““?zhuyan?=?““?difang?=?““
leibie?=?““;
String?logname?=?““?text?=?““;
int?pageSize?=?2;
int?showPage?=?1;
int?pageAllCount?=?0;
int?a?=?0;//?計算字段個數
CachedRowSetImpl?rowSet;
//?構造函數
public?database()?{
queryResult?=?new?StringBuffer();
}
public?void?chaxun(String?str?String?biao)?{
Connection?con;
Statement?sql;
ResultSet?rs;
String?uri?=?“jdbc:mysql://localhost:3306/movie“;//?或者“jdbc:mysql://localhost/shuju”,不用寫端口
try?{
queryResult.append(““);
Class.forName(“com.mysql.jdbc.Driver“);
con?=?DriverManager.getConnection(uri?“root“?“root“);
DatabasemetaData?metadata?=?con.getmetaData();
ResultSet?rs1?=?metadata.getColumns(null?null?biao?null);
queryResult.append(““);
while?(rs1.next())?{
a++;
String?clumnName?=?rs1.getString(4);
queryResult.append(““?+?clumnName?+?“ “);
}
queryResult.append(“ “);
sql?=?con.createStatement();
rs?=?sql.executeQuery(str);
rowSet?=?new?CachedRowSetImpl();
rowSet.populate(rs);
rowSet.last();
int?m?=?rowSet.getRow();
int?n?=?pageSize;
pageAllCount?=?((m?%?n)?==?0)???(m?/?n)?:?(m?/?n?+?1);
if?(showPage?>?pageAllCount)
showPage?=?1;
if?(showPage?<=?0)
showPage?=?pageAllCount;
try?{
rowSet.absolute((showPage?-?1)?*?pageSize?+?1);
for?(int?i?=?1;?i?<=?pageSize;?i++)?{
queryResult.append(““);
for?(int?k?=?1;?k?<=?a;?k++)
queryResult.append(““?+?rowSet.getString(k)
+?“ “);
queryResult.append(“ “);
rowSet.next();
}
}?catch?(SQLException?e)?{
e.printStackTrace();
}
queryResult.append(“
“);
con.close();
}?catch?(Exception?e)?{
queryResult.append(e);
}
}
//?順序查詢,在本例中是“新片”的方法,查詢出上映時間在一年內的電影
public?StringBuffer?getShunxuchaxun()?{
chaxun(“select?*?from?movie?where?(2011-shangyingshijian)<=1“?“movie“);
return?queryResult;
}
//?“分類”的方法
public?StringBuffer?getTiaojianchaxun()?{
Connection?con;
Statement?sql;
ResultSet?rs;
String?uri?=?“jdbc:mysql://localhost:3306/movie?useUnicode=true&characterEncoding=UTF-8“;
try?{
queryResult.append(““);
Class.forName(“com.mysql.jdbc.Driver“);
con?=?DriverManager.getConnection(uri?“root“?“root“);
DatabasemetaData?metadata?=?con.getmetaData();
ResultSet?rs1?=?metadata.getColumns(null?null?“movie“?null);
int?a?=?0;
queryResult.append(““);
while?(rs1.next())?{
a++;
String?clumnName?=?rs1.getString(4);
?屬性????????????大小?????日期????時間???名稱
-----------?---------??----------?-----??----
?????文件????????705??2013-06-30?09:07??movie2\.classpath
?????文件????????291??2013-06-30?09:01??movie2\.mymetadata
?????文件???????1749??2013-06-30?09:01??movie2\.project
?????文件????????500??2013-06-30?09:01??movie2\.settings\.jsdtscope
?????文件????????109??2012-04-13?17:25??movie2\.settings\com.genuitec.eclipse.ws.prefs
?????文件????????395??2013-06-30?09:01??movie2\.settings\org.eclipse.jdt.core.prefs
?????文件????????456??2013-06-30?09:01??movie2\.settings\org.eclipse.wst.common.component
?????文件????????252??2013-06-30?09:01??movie2\.settings\org.eclipse.wst.common.project.facet.core.xml
?????文件?????????49??2013-06-30?09:01??movie2\.settings\org.eclipse.wst.jsdt.ui.superType.container
?????文件??????????6??2013-06-30?09:01??movie2\.settings\org.eclipse.wst.jsdt.ui.superType.name
?????文件???????9483??2013-06-30?10:03??movie2\src\beans\database.java
?????文件????????664??2012-04-13?17:25??movie2\src\beans\Login.java
?????文件????????669??2012-04-13?17:25??movie2\src\beans\ManagerLogin.java
?????文件???????1484??2012-04-13?17:25??movie2\src\beans\MovieInform.java
?????文件????????633??2012-04-13?17:25??movie2\src\beans\Register.java
?????文件???????1821??2013-06-30?10:08??movie2\src\handle\HandleDatabase.java
?????文件???????3308??2013-06-30?15:42??movie2\src\handle\HandleLogin.java
?????文件???????3097??2013-06-30?10:08??movie2\src\handle\HandleManagerLogin.java
?????文件???????3073??2013-06-30?10:08??movie2\src\handle\HandleRegister.java
?????文件???????3178??2013-06-30?14:32??movie2\WebRoot\fenlei.jsp
?????文件????????605??2013-06-30?14:31??movie2\WebRoot\header.jsp
?????文件????????766??2012-04-13?17:25??movie2\WebRoot\img\abclg.png
?????文件???????5874??2012-04-13?17:25??movie2\WebRoot\img\pic1.jpg
?????文件???????5240??2012-04-13?17:25??movie2\WebRoot\img\pic2.jpg
?????文件???????6094??2012-04-13?17:25??movie2\WebRoot\img\pic3.jpg
?????文件???????4569??2012-04-13?17:25??movie2\WebRoot\img\pic4.jpg
?????文件???????3914??2012-04-13?17:25??movie2\WebRoot\img\pic5.jpg
?????文件???????5966??2012-04-13?17:25??movie2\WebRoot\img\pic6.jpg
?????文件???????4427??2012-04-13?17:25??movie2\WebRoot\img\pic7.jpg
?????文件???????5155??2012-04-13?17:25??movie2\WebRoot\img\pic8.jpg
............此處省略48個文件信息
- 上一篇:Android 日歷+記事本+提醒
- 下一篇:個人健康運動管理系統
評論
共有 條評論
相關資源
-
java 畢業設計 進銷存管理系統 源碼
-
adb 1.0.31版本--解決4.3android系統adb of
-
基于java的在線考試系統-畢業設計
-
微博系統(Java源碼,servlet+jsp),適
-
JSP企業人事管理系統設計(源代碼+論
-
實現一個圖書管理系統
-
JAVA JSP公司財務管理系統 源代碼 論文
-
JSP+MYSQL旅行社管理信息系統
-
基于Java的酒店管理系統源碼(畢業設
-
在線聊天系統(java代碼)
-
基于Java的圖書管理系統807185
-
java 企業銷售管理系統
-
java做的聊天系統(包括正規課程設計
-
JSP,SQL,MVC的選課系統
-
基于JSP的學生宿舍管理系統(源碼 數
-
JSP選課管理系統
-
mysql jsp網站源碼下載
-
JSP做的化妝品商城
-
Jsp購物車實例
-
商店商品管理系統 JAVA寫的 有界面
-
基于JSP的校友信息管理系統(添加數
-
在linux系統下用java執行系統命令實例
-
java做的房產管理系統
-
基于jsp的bbs論壇 非常詳細
-
操作系統作業 (pv,作業管理,等5個
-
基于C/S架構考試系統(Java)
-
java access 倉庫管理系統 源碼
-
jsp oracle通訊錄
-
JSP學生信息管理系統 Mysql數據庫
-
使用jsp servlet做的投票系統